◉ What would indicate a restriction (such as dirt or scale) in the
liquid line? Answer: Frost immediately after the restriction
◉ What does solubility mean? Answer: The ability of a
refrigerant to mix with other substances
◉ Charging Vapor —In a compression system, where do you
charge the vapor? Answer: Suction side of the compressor at the
Suction Service Valve
◉ When comparing a brine with s PH of 8 to one with a PH of
10, its alkalinity is: Answer: 100 times greater (ex. PH 8 to PH 9
is 10 times greater)
◉ In an efficiently operating induced draft cooling tower, the
leaving water is between: Answer: Dry bulb and wet bulb
temperature
◉ To produce the desired evaporator temperature, the power
input is reduced by keeping head pressure... Answer: Head
pressure as low as possible & suction pressure as high as needed
◉ The accumulator is usually between the... Answer:
Compressor and evaporator
◉ An oiling system in a large centrifugal system should consist
of at least... Answer: Reservoir, pump and distribution lines
,◉ In an evaporator that chills brine, the greatest cooling effect
on the brine results from the... Answer: Boiling of low pressure
liquid

◉ If the insulation was removed from the bulb of the expansion
valve, what would happen? Answer: Flooded evaporator —the
TXV bulb opens in a range from 45 to 85° F. If the insulation
was removed, the bulb would sense the temperature in the
machine room and keep the TXV open, thus flooding the
evaporator.
